Baba Bageshwar Dhirendra Shastri has once again stirred political debate in Bihar with his latest statement during the Hanumant Katha in Gopalganj. He declared that he will undertake a Padayatra across Uttar Pradesh and Bihar to unite Hindus for the cause of making India a Hindu Rashtra. Questioning the objections to this idea, he asserted that Hindus must come together to establish their religious identity in the country. His statement has sparked strong political reactions, with supporters hailing it as a step toward cultural resurgence, while critics argue it may deepen religious divisions. The Padayatra announcement is expected to further escalate discussions on nationalism and religious identity, particularly in Bihar’s volatile political climate. As preparations for the yatra begin, its impact on the socio-political landscape of UP and Bihar will be keenly observed.
